Exposure to violence, victimization differences and maxillofacial injuries in a Brazilian state capital: a data mining approach
ConclusionGender is an important factor related to violence exposure and maxillofacial injuries. Young adult men were more likely to exhibit severe maxillofacial injuries compared to women. It is necessary to challenge interpersonal violence through awareness, prevention and education programs. Efforts to minimize the impact of violence on the population health and well-being require specific guidelines in Brazil.
